How We Calculated 196.003 KG to LBS

Conversion Formula

Pounds = Kilograms × 2.20462262185

Step-by-Step Calculation

  1. Start with the value in kilograms: 196.003 kg
  2. Multiply by the conversion factor: 196.003 × 2.20462262185
  3. Complete the multiplication: 432.1126 lbs
  4. Round to practical precision: 432.11 lbs

Why This Conversion Factor?

The conversion factor 2.20462262185 represents the exact number of pounds in one kilogram, as defined by international measurement standards. This precise value ensures accuracy for scientific, commercial, and everyday applications.
